What is the cheapest month to fly from Newcastle upon Tyne to Kathmandu?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Newcastle upon Tyne to Kathmandu,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Newcastle upon Tyne to Kathmandu is February, where tickets cost £918 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are August and July,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is £1,344 and £1,245 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Newcastle upon Tyne to Kathmandu?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ly to Kathmandu with an airline and back to Newcastle upon Tyne with another airline.
